iOS, with its robust ecosystem of apps and powerful hardware, offers a rich playground for short video stylization. The native camera app provides a solid foundation, offering features like slow-motion capture, time-lapse, and basic filters. While these tools are sufficient for casual users, the real magic lies within the vast array of third-party apps designed to push creative boundaries.

One of the key trends in short video stylization is the emphasis on filters. From vintage film emulations to vibrant color grading, filters can instantly transform the mood and aesthetic of a video. Apps like VSCO, Lightroom Mobile, and Filmm offer a wide range of professional-grade filters, allowing users to achieve specific cinematic looks. These apps also provide granular control over parameters like contrast, saturation, and sharpness, enabling fine-tuning for optimal results.

Beyond filters, effects play a crucial role in elevating short videos. Glitch effects, light leaks, and vintage overlays can add a touch of nostalgia or artistic flair. Apps like Mextures and Afterlight offer a diverse collection of effects that can be layered and blended to create unique visual styles. The ability to customize the intensity and placement of these effects further enhances creative control.

Transitions are another essential element of short video stylization. Smooth transitions between clips create a polished and professional feel. While basic cuts and fades are readily available in most editing apps, more advanced transitions like whip pans, zooms, and morphing effects can add dynamism and visual interest. Apps like InShot and VN offer a wide array of transitions, simplifying the process of creating seamless and engaging video sequences.

Text overlays and animated graphics are increasingly popular in short video stylization. Adding text can convey information, add humor, or enhance the narrative. Apps like Canva and Adobe Spark Post offer templates and design tools for creating visually appealing text overlays. Animated graphics, such as stickers and GIFs, can further enhance the entertainment value of a video. Platforms like GIPHY integrate seamlessly with many video editing apps, providing access to a vast library of animated content.

Music and sound design are integral to the overall impact of a short video. Choosing the right music track can set the tone and evoke specific emotions. Many video editing apps offer built-in music libraries or integrations with music streaming services. Sound effects can also add depth and realism to a video, enhancing the immersive experience. Apps like Splice and LumaFusion offer advanced audio editing capabilities, allowing users to fine-tune the sound design of their videos.

The rise of AI-powered tools has further democratized short video stylization. Apps like FaceApp and Prisma leverage AI to apply artistic styles and effects to videos, transforming ordinary footage into stunning visuals. These tools often require minimal user input, making it easier than ever to create visually compelling content.
